Galvanize Launches Exclusive Apprenticeship Program in Partnership with Pivotal Labs
San Francisco, CA (PRWEB) July 23, 2014 -- Galvanize, a network of urban campuses for digital innovators and entrepreneurs that combines education, experience and industry under one roof, and Pivotal Labs, the agile services unit of Pivotal and a leader in highly disciplined agile software development practices, today announced the formation of an exclusive apprenticeship program offered through Galvanize’s gSchool that provides students with real-world job experience working full-time alongside Pivotal Labs engineers.
Pivotal Labs at gSchool offers students the opportunity to apply their technology development and coding skills to practical software development for Pivotal Labs clients.
“Some of the top brands in the world hire Pivotal Labs to develop their mobile and web solutions and their engineers are among the best and brightest in the industry, making Pivotal Labs the perfect partner for a gSchool apprenticeship program,” said Jim Deters, CEO of Galvanize. “Students will help write real software for real clients, and deliver value to real customers, further enhancing the gSchool experience.”
During the last phase of the gSchool program, all students will work onsite at Pivotal Labs, providing them with an apprenticeship at no extra cost. Students will receive the guidance and support they need from gSchool instructors and staff while “pairing” with Pivotal Labs engineers, just as developers operate in a real work setting known as Pair Programming. gSchool students will graduate with experience delivering production-level code on real projects to showcase to potential employers.
“Pivotal Labs at gSchool will serve as a working job interview for students,” said Deters. “Pivotal Labs and its clients will get exposure to rising talent, while gSchool students receive invaluable hands-on experience with prospective employers.”
gSchool, which launched its first immersive developer training program in January 2013, is now on its fourth class and boasts a 98 percent placement rate. gSchool graduates have secured developer jobs at competitive employers including GoSpotCheck, Pivotal Labs and SendGrid. The upcoming fall class at Galvanize’s San Francisco campus will be the first to feature Pivotal Labs at gSchool, and all gSchool immersive programs across the entire Galvanize network of campuses will include the apprenticeship program by the end of the year. Galvanize announced last month that it has received $18 million in Series A funding that will go towards opening new campuses across the U.S. and significantly expanding gSchool, with plans to launch several new programs this fall. Galvanize is also growing its footprint in San Francisco with an expansion of its SoMa campus to 70,000 square feet, adding gSchool classroom, meeting and event spaces, including a 250-seat auditorium.

About gSchool
gSchool is the education operation at Galvanize, a network of urban campuses for digital innovators and entrepreneurs that aligns work and learning by combining education, experience and industry under one roof. gSchool students attend full-time, 24-week immersive developer training programs that help shape them into confident and employable developers who turn real business needs into exceptional software. Since launching its first campus in Denver in October 2012, Galvanize has expanded to San Francisco, California, and Boulder, Colorado, with more campuses due to open throughout the U.S. in 2014 and 2015. Each campus offers training and education opportunities, tech-focused events and a variety of workspace options. The organization was co-founded by three entrepreneurs – Jim Deters, Lawrence Mandes and Chris Onan – with a shared vision of creating a galvanized community to serve digital innovators at any stage of their entrepreneurial journey.
